Why Pico Rivera Yards Need Professional Care

Summer temperatures regularly hit the 90s here, stressing lawns and requiring careful watering management to avoid burning grass or wasting water. The hot, dry Santa Ana winds that blow through in fall dehydrate plants quickly and increase fire risk from dry vegetation. Winter brings occasional heavy rains that overwhelm poor drainage and create muddy messes. Your yard faces different challenges every season, and each one requires specific care.

Many Pico Rivera homeowners struggle with balancing water conservation requirements with keeping their landscapes healthy. We install efficient irrigation systems that use smart controllers to adjust watering based on weather and plant needs. For properties that want to eliminate lawn watering entirely, our artificial turf installations provide year-round green spaces without water bills. These solutions work particularly well for the smaller yard sizes common in neighborhoods like Rivera Village and Pico Gardens where every square foot matters.
